A bubbling pot of jam fills my kitchen with the scent of summer. All it takes is fresh berries, sugar, pectin, and a squeeze of lemon juice. I follow the recipe on the pectin box, cook until thickened, pour into jars, and store in the fridge or pantry. Homemade jam tastes amazing on toast, pancakes, or even ice cream.

The NE Ohio Quilt Show @Wooster
Sponsored by A Quilters Destination of PA. 55 vendors. Over 200 quilts from The Tree City Quilters. 18 classes. 12 free lectures. Free admission, free parking and a free raffle to win over $1200 worth of vendor donated quilt supplies. Food on the premises.

One of Friendship Park’s most extraordinary features is the Moon Tree, a sycamore grown from seeds that traveled to the moon aboard Apollo 14. Planted during the U.S. bicentennial, this marvel stands near shelters 1, 2, and 3. It’s the last of Ohio’s three Moon Trees—a must-see for visitors.
